BELL, Judge:

On February 7, 1989, Alice Postell Wilkins shot and killed William Legree Ferrell in a car on Rushland Landing Road in Charleston County. She was indicted and tried for murder in the Court of General Sessions. The jury found her guilty of voluntary manslaughter for which the court sentenced her to twenty years imprisonment.
